          Estelle sat down at the Slytherin table, followed by her fellow snakes.

She looked up at the head table and caught Severus' eye. He gave her a barely noticeable nod that told her she had complete control of the snakes. Not that she cared, considering she would have done whatever she wanted to do with them anyway. But she does like to know she has his complete confidence.

As she was looking away, she saw that Quirrell was looking at her with red eyes. She smirked and gave him a wink. She could tell it riled him up. She just laughed to herself. Who knew it was so easy to piss off a Dark Lord?

Her friends looked at her curiously. She just shook her head — indicating she'll tell them later.

She went to go take food off the table to plate but looked at her plate to see it was already full. Looking up in front of her, she saw Draco looking around the room like it was the most interesting thing in the world.

"Thank you, cousin." she thanked with a full smile, that got all the boys and some girls around her to blush.

Draco looked at them all in barely concealed disgust, "I promised mother to look after you." he muttered.

Estelle shook her head with a smile. Of course she did, that's Narcissa for you.

Her first class of the day is Herbology with the Hufflepuffs. She likes the Hufflepuffs; they're nice, but she knew not to underestimate them — unlike some people.

Estelle surveyed the Hufflepuff table. They would be of use. After all, badgers eat snakes. She would have to befriend Susan Bones, as her Aunt, Amelia, is the head of DMLE. And who knows? Maybe a good friendship could happen.

Her eyes stopped on Cedric Diggory. She had taken a long time to get over his death — even after she had  died. She felt as if his death was her fault. But she accepted that it happened and visited him in the afterlife. He will make it this time, and if not: she'll drag him back from the dead and have a big talk with Mortimer.

Blaise, who sat beside her, nudged her shoulder a little. "You okay? You spaced out for a bit," he asked, concerned.

Estelle cleared her throat and shot him a smile that looked slightly unfriendly, "I am, thank you for asking."

Draco waved his hand at Blaise and the others, "Don't worry, she's always like that when she's scheming. You'll get used to it."

All of them nodded — as if everything about her was explained.

Estelle gasped in mock offence, "Cousin! I feel betrayed! How dare you tell people my darkest secret."

They all looked at her with a deadpan expression. She sighed. Yeah, even she didn't believe a word she said.

"Anyways," Estelle rolled her eyes, "Blaise," said boy looked at her upon hearing his name, "I was wondering if you could send a letter to your mother for me." she had a lovesick look on her face, "I'm a huge fan. Do you think she could teach me some things?"

All boys near her scooted away from her slightly, while all the girls scooted closer.

Blaise cleared his throat, "I-I can, yes, that's fine."

"Sweet," Estelle turned to the girls, "Did you see the latest witch weekly? It's horrendous what Kimberly Finber said about Jorga Vega." All the girls nodded and started talking about it. The boys looked at them, alarmed, wasn't she just talking about her awe for a famous Black Widow?

Before they could get too deep in their gossip, owls started coming through with letters from parents and other family members.

The Malfoy family owl, Thor, dropped in front of Draco with two letters, one for him and the other for Estelle.

Estelle took the letter with a giddy smile. Carefully opening it, she began to read,

'Dearest Estelle,

Well done for making Queen your second week! Your grandmother, Uncle, and I couldn't be prouder.

Your grandmother has asked me to tell you to remember to read your star chart every night — she used to make your father and uncle Regulus do the same thing.'

Estelle paused her reading and chuckled. Typical grandmother Walburga.

'Did you hear about what Kimberly Finber said about Jorga Vega? Appalling. Such a shame, I almost liked her. But Jorga will always be our number one.

Update me when you're back for the yule holidays, and your grandmother, yourself and I can all have tea and discuss any gossip you've heard, as will we.

Now, on to other matters. We've heard who you have befriended and are happy with your pick, but we know there will be more.

Draco has told us in his letter what happened at the duel, and it's easy to say you are his favourite person. I would be lying if I said it didn't hurt, but who am I to have such feelings if you, too, are my favourite. Don't tell Draco or Lucius — although it would be rather amusing to watch their reactions.

Attached are some sweets and other treats for you and your friends if you so wish to share. I also included a bag of mice for your spoiled snake.

Look after Draco for me.

With love,

Aunt Cissa'

Estelle lifted her head slowly to meet Dracos' icy blue eyes and smirked, "So I'm your favourite?" she teased.

Dracos' cheeks suddenly had a pink tinge to them. He opened his mouth and shouted, "That snitch!" he pointed at the letter accusingly.

All his friends laughed as Pansy who sat beside him pouted mockingly, "Oh yes, how very sad. How dare she!" Draco, who didn't know she was being sarcastic, nodded, until Pansy turned to Estelle with eyes full of amusement, "Send my thanks to Lady Malfoy."

Draco gave a dramatic gasp. Ah, the Black genes. He placed his hand on the right side of his chest, "The betrayal!" He cried, "My heart!"

They all looked at him unbothered.

"Your hearts on the other side, idiot." said the normally quiet Odette.

Everyone laughed at Draco. However, Estelle was looking at Odette with calculating eyes — which held the question; 𝘄𝗵𝗼 𝗶𝘀 𝗢𝗱𝗲𝘁𝘁𝗲 𝗪𝗵𝗶𝘁𝗲?

She had never heard of her when she first lived; but, then again, she was held back by Granger and Weasley. But, that still didn't answer her question.

She may not know now, but she will.

Estelle now sat on one of the benches in Greenhouse one — for Herbology.

And it is just her luck that Susan Bones was the lucky Hufflepuff to be seated next to her. This made her plan much easier.

She sent the Hufflepuff a small smile, which she instantly returned. 'Interesting', thought Estelle, she doesn't seem to be afraid. In fact, none of the Hufflepuffs did. She wondered if there was some secret sort of alliance. And if there isn't, she'll make one.

Last week - her first week - she hadn't observed anyone in her classes, nor had she introduced herself. Everyone knew who she was, of course, but they didn't know her.

"Merry meet Heiress Bones," greeted Estelle, "Heiress Potter-Black of the Most Noble and Ancient House of Potter and Black." she introduced as if Bones didn't know who she was, "I would curtsy, but seeing as we're sitting down..." she trailed off.

Bones sent her a smile, but there was a small calculating look in her eye — almost unnoticeable to most, but not Estelle. And she knew why. Bones was supposed to introduce herself first as she is of lesser social standing than Estelle; so for her (Estelle) to introduce herself first means that she wants to build an ally with the house of Bones. "Well met, Heiress Potter-Black. Heiress Bones of the Noble and Ancient House of Bones."

Estelle sent her a too sharp smile, "Lovely to make your acquaintance, I'm sure we will be lovely friends."

Susan searched her face and, too, gave a smile too sharp, "Yes, I think we will."

"Great." said Estelle as Susan turned away to look at where Professor Sprout had just entered, "Just great."

After finishing her morning classes, Estelle made her way to the great hall for lunch.

As she turned the corner, she collided with another person. She felt her eyes widen, slightly; as she looked at who she had run into.

The infamous Weasley twins.

They also felt their eyes widen as they saw her. They looked at each other and grinned; thinking the same thing.

They got on their knees and put their hands together in a pleading motion, "Oh our Lady, please forgive us for we have sinned." they said together.

"For we almost maimed and killed our shining light," said Fred.

"Our Lady," continued George.

"Please forgive us for we have sinned." they finished.

Estelle looked at them blankly, "I like that." was all she said as she turned and walked away, knowing they would follow.

As predicted, they followed. They fell in line with her slow pace.

"I know about you two," said Estelle looking straight ahead as if she saw something they didn't. Which she did — she saw her daughter, Helena, at the end of the corridor reading their favourite book 'Little Women'. "All about you."

The twins gave each other a glance, "What do you mean, M'Lady?" asked George, the more serious one.

Estelle continued looking at her daughter, as she had stopped walking. "About your family. More precisely — your mother."

Before she became the Mistress of Death — when she first lived as Estelle — she remembers how Molly Weasley had treated her children, that weren't Ronald or Ginerva, but she had never thought twice about it; stupid compulsions!

Now, at this current moment in time, all she feels for Molly Weasley is disgust; more that she's a mother herself. Helena is her daughter, her flesh and blood. If she had multiple Helenas', she couldn't imagine neglecting one or more. Hell, she couldn't think of neglecting any child atoll.

The love of a mother can never be rivalled.

"She has mistreated you and your older brothers," Estelle said in a small voice, void of emotion, but her eyes — oh her eyes, were full of so much rage they almost flinched. "I can fix that, well not fix, but I can avenge."

She turned to look at the twins with a look in her killing curse green eyes that made them know she wasn't lying to them or giving them false hope.

"Only if we can help." They said,

"Of course. After all, that's the best part of revenge —taking part."

And in that moment, the twins knew that they had given their loyalty to the green-eyed lady.

And they didn't, nor will they ever regret it.
